Flat Rock came into Wednesday's game having lost four straight, but that streak is now in the rearview. They put the hurt on the St. Mary Catholic Central Falcons/Kestrels with a sharp 9-1 win on Wednesday. Flat Rock's offense finally found a way to get into gear: the high-octane performance was a 180-degree turn from their last six games.
Flat Rock's victory bumped their record up to 4-5-1. As for St. Mary Catholic Central, their loss was their fifth straight on the road, which dropped their record down to 1-9-1.
Flat Rock will take on Jefferson at 5:30 p.m. on Monday. As for St. Mary Catholic Central, they will be playing in front of their home fans against Tecumseh at 4:30 p.m. on Friday.
